Transaction 5948ca5732633d5df4970961f5fbe12834a2471d98ccbe4eaf1dfa949ff3f422

3 Input
1 Outputs
  • 5948ca5732633d5df4970961f5fbe12834a2471d98ccbe4eaf1dfa949ff3f422:0
  • value  1374280
    address  34EafnSkQ3YvpwAQ1janxJrns5FqH6Terx